The Israeli-Palestinian conflict has led to the suspension of logistics for some e-cigarette shipments, which is expected to be delayed by two weeks to January

Recently, the conflict between Israel and Palestine escalated, and Israel officially declared war on Hamas. Affected by this, China has suspended shipments of some e-cigarette freight forwarders to Israel, with logistics expected to be delayed by two weeks to a month.
Recently, a conflict broke out between Israel and Palestine, and Israel officially declared war on Hamas. What impact will the Israeli-Palestinian conflict have on the e-cigarette trade in Israel and surrounding Middle Eastern countries?
According to Chinese customs data, in August this year, the amount of e-cigarettes exported from China to Israel ranked 54th among all exporting countries, with a total export value of approximately 800000 US dollars, equivalent to 5.84 million yuan, an increase of 64.69% month on month. From the data, there is a significant upward trend in China's e-cigarette exports to Israel. At the same time, China's e-cigarette exports to Egypt, Türkiye, Jordan and other countries around Israel have all shown an upward trend, of which the exports to Egypt have increased by 113.73% month on month.
So, after the escalation of the Israeli-Palestinian conflict, what is the situation of e-cigarette shipments in the surrounding countries and regions of Israel? Some e-cigarette freight forwarding companies have stopped shipping to Israel.
After the outbreak of the Israeli-Palestinian conflict, many customers still seek logistics channels to Israel. However, due to the fact that the company provides full compensation services for customs clearance, in order to avoid unnecessary losses and risks, the Israeli company's channels have stopped receiving goods. Currently, shipments from other regions in the Middle East are normal.
Another logistics company's sales consultant, who cannot disclose the company's name, said that electronic cigarette manufacturers are currently shipping to the Middle East through this company. Electronic cigarettes sent to the Middle East are usually first sent to Dubai, United Arab Emirates, and then transported locally to neighboring countries, so the current impact of the Israeli-Palestinian conflict on logistics and customs clearance is not significant. But it has a certain impact on market sales, and the consumer market in conflict countries will temporarily decrease. At present, mainland UPS express delivery can be sent to Israel or air freight to the airport, but the recipient needs to clear customs and pay taxes.
The Palestine Israel conflict also has a great impact on the logistics of Egypt, Türkiye and countries around Jordan, except for the conflict countries. The main current situation of the entire Middle East e-cigarette logistics is that it relies on Dubai, the United Arab Emirates, to transfer to other countries (regions), while 80% to 90% of the transfer is by land and transported by truck. War and armed forces can lead to damage to roads and instability of public security, and the impact on logistics will be very intuitive. Timeliness will slow down, and unsafe factors will also increase.
Although conflicts may lead to a decrease in market demand in the region, e-cigarette companies will not give up. Just as the conflict between Russia-Ukraine conflict is still going on, there will still be e-cigarette enterprises seeking logistics channels for shipments from Russia and Ukraine. At present, the time of the conflict between Palestine and Israel is relatively short and we have not received any feedback from the front. However, according to the logistics situation in Russia and Ukraine, the logistics of e-cigarettes sent to the troubled areas after the war is two weeks to a month slower than before.
